// Heads-up for the sync: this constant is the polling interval
// for the Wrenfield barcode scanner bridge. The vendor firmware
// chokes if we poll faster than 200ms, so don't "optimize" this
// down again — yes, it happened twice. Any change needs a bench
// run on real hardware. Tag results with the build token below.

trace token, kahog-tajeg: htk6_97d963

Handover — crate SRV-7 of survey instruments bound for the Midlock ridge site. Contents: two total stations, tripods, and the levelling kit, all calibrated last week by our Pemberly workshop. The crate is weather-sealed and must stay flat in transit; desiccant packs were refreshed this morning. Receiving should check the tilt indicator on arrival before signing. The confidential instruction for the courier hand-over sits just under this note.

handover note for yagef-bagep: the drudor pelius courier leaves the kasdor zorvan norir ledger at gate 8016 under passcode 755406

The renewal of our three-year agreement with Torvane Materials has been assessed in detail. Proposed terms include a 4.2% unit-price increase, partially offset by improved volume rebates and extended payment terms of sixty days. Sensitivity analysis indicates a net annual cost impact of under 1% on the Meridia product line, assuming stable demand. Legal has flagged no material changes to liability clauses. We recommend approval, subject to the conditions outlined in the confidential note below.

confidential, yawip-bahif: Zorokox Partners plans to lower the Casax list price by 28.0 percent in April. The board signed off on a budget of $271.0 million for Project Juldor. The renewal with Pelokox Partners closes at $410.1 million a year, 3.4 percent below the last contract. Project Pelok slips by a full year because of the audit delay.

The reminder job for Willowgate Clinic runs hourly, pulling appointments 48 hours out and dispatching SMS and email through the Chimeport relay. Failed sends retry three times, then land in the dead-letter view support can replay. Do not replay more than once per patient per day. Replay calls hit the internal relay endpoint and must include the key below.

service key, fawip-bajef: kto11_Qt5wZK9vdNC